How the whole thing sounds
The situation: a police station for foreigners, the document intake window. The conversation is short and predictable — which is exactly what makes it good for a first try: few lines, and almost all of them repeat from one exchange to the next.
- Добар дан, дошао сам да пријавим боравак. Ево личне карте и уговора о закупу.Dobar dan, došao sam da prijavim boravak. Evo lične karte i ugovora o zakupu.Good afternoon, I've come to register my residence. Here's my ID and the lease agreement.
- Документа се предају на шалтеру број пет. Имате ли и копију пасоша?Dokumenta se predaju na šalteru broj pet. Imate li i kopiju pasoša?Documents are submitted at window number five. Do you have a copy of your passport?
- Имам копију, али није оверена. Да ли је то проблем?Imam kopiju, ali nije overena. Da li je to problem?I have a copy, but it's not certified. Is that a problem?
- За пријаву боравка није. За радну дозволу јесте — тамо се тражи оверена копија.Za prijavu boravka nije. Za radnu dozvolu jeste — tamo se traži overena kopija.For registration, no. For a work permit, yes — there a certified copy is required.
- Разумем. А колики је рок за решавање захтева?Razumem. A koliki je rok za rešavanje zahteva?I see. And how long does it take to process an application?
- Тридесет дана, али бели картон добијате одмах, још данас.Trideset dana, ali beli karton dobijate odmah, još danas.Thirty days, but you get the migration card right away, today in fact.
- А ако одбију захтев? Могу ли онда да уложим жалбу?A ako odbiju zahtev? Mogu li onda da uložim žalbu?And if the application is rejected? Can I file a complaint then?
- Можете, у року од петнаест дана. Али тешко да ће одбити, папири су вам у реду.Možete, u roku od petnaest dana. Ali teško da će odbiti, papiri su vam u redu.You can, within fifteen days. But they're unlikely to refuse; your papers are in order.

How to prepare for a conversation like this
Memorizing the lines is not enough: the other person will say their own thing, not what is written. What helps more is catching the key words by ear and keeping three rescue phrases ready: “I don't understand”, “repeat, please”, “slower”.
And one more thing phrasebooks do not mention: awkwardness gets in the way more than not knowing the words.
- Fear of making mistakes gets in the way of learning a language, and it gets in the way badly. It is one of the most reliably measured findings in the entire field.checked many timesTeimouri, Goetze & Plonsky, 2019, Studies in Second Language Acquisition 41(2) · 19,933 participants from 23 countries; correlation with results r = −0.36.
- That fear can be dealt with — the methods have been tested and they work.checked many timesXiong et al., 2024, Journal of Language and Social Psychology · 37 studies, anxiety reduced by −0.61. Of the seven conditions examined, only age turned out to matter.
